Understanding Roofing Drainage Mats and Their Functionality

Roofing drainage mats play a crucial role in effective water management on flat roofs. Their primary function is to facilitate drainage while protecting the underlying structure. By preventing water accumulation, these mats help extend the lifespan of roofing materials. According to a report by the National Roofing Contractors Association, proper drainage can enhance roof performance by 30%. This stat highlights their importance in any roofing project.

These mats are designed to manage runoff effectively. They allow excess water to flow freely, reducing pooling and potential leaks. Innovative designs have made these mats lightweight and easy to install. In fact, some studies indicate that proper installation can decrease rooftop weight by 15%. However, improper use can lead to issues like erosion under the mat or blocked drainage paths. It's essential to choose the right materials based on specific project needs.

The versatility of roofing drainage mats also offers additional benefits. They can support vegetation in green roofs, contributing to environmental sustainability. A study by the Green Roofs for Healthy Cities organization states that green roofs can reduce urban heat islands by 7 degrees Fahrenheit. However, selecting inappropriate drainage solutions can negate these benefits. Monitoring and maintenance remain critical to ensure longevity and effectiveness in a roofing system.

Cost-Effectiveness: Savings on Maintenance and Repairs

Roofing drainage mats offer significant cost-effectiveness by reducing maintenance and repair expenses. According to a report from the National Roofing Contractors Association, commercial roofs can lose up to 20% of their lifespan due to improper drainage. When water pools on the roof, it leads to leaks and structural damage over time. By installing drainage mats, buildings can effectively channel water away. This can extend the roof's lifespan and reduce repair costs by as much as 30%.

Additionally, a study by the American Society of Civil Engineers notes that proper drainage minimizes water-related issues. The report highlights that roofs with efficient drainage systems are less likely to develop mold and mildew. These issues can lead to health risks and costly remediation efforts. Hence, investing in roofing drainage mats not only prevents immediate issues but also minimizes long-term expenditures.

While the initial investment for these mats is modest, the potential savings are substantial. Property owners can save thousands in repairs and maintenance. However, it’s crucial to regularly inspect and maintain drainage systems. Neglecting this can result in unforeseen issues down the line. Proper installation and periodic maintenance are vital for ensuring the mats perform effectively. When done right, these mats can be a valuable asset to any roofing project.
